Output 33c5bb1738981ae4928144d39a9e5b1225fdd46d817470e658ae88871ac32ac2:5

value
514681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455c0c16d4663b369499948533640e62303f86eb OP_EQUAL
address
381kpLHKJb6YH18GrvdmNpqztUVPWQkehz
transaction
33c5bb1738981ae4928144d39a9e5b1225fdd46d817470e658ae88871ac32ac2
spent
true